Transaction 71dc1395410e1ec51084f7531891db754cd5fb7a973a2dba231f2bee3a36fb15

1 Input
2 Outputs
  • 71dc1395410e1ec51084f7531891db754cd5fb7a973a2dba231f2bee3a36fb15:0
  • value  500000
    address  3EdfiZh1zjQgBkqAmCazxb3mRatJNTCeju
  • 71dc1395410e1ec51084f7531891db754cd5fb7a973a2dba231f2bee3a36fb15:1
  • value  107699
    address  37j7q1FBwJV9LQuEx2pVfTLMuybeND2Hr4